Output cdb598cd267d59c3d640518b69315a35f30d70db3f52e0e8f26d797aa8bfcd94:3

value
20630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71285ef6e1b46cf84f854ba1ce6c60cd26516110 OP_EQUAL
address
3C1LeF638m4W8VNsvjRrzSiYmEsYz5ctVv
transaction
cdb598cd267d59c3d640518b69315a35f30d70db3f52e0e8f26d797aa8bfcd94
spent
true